Product Description:

Fooling around with Photoshop to create interesting composite artwork is all well and good. But if you rely on Photoshop to meet tough production challenges in a fast-paced professional environment, fooling around won't cut it! You need results, and you need them now: This book delivers! In this copiously illustrated volume, best-selling authors David Blatner and Bruce Fraser offer scads of hands-on production techniques as well as clear explanations of the concepts that drive them, so that you can get the best results possible on your own Photoshop CS2 projects. You'll learn about managing color, getting great scans, correcting tones and colors, and more. You also find complete coverage of all of Photoshop CS2's newest features: integration with Adobe Bridge; Vanishing Point; super-tight integration with the rest of Adobe's Creative Suite 2; and more. Throughout, the emphasis is on efficiency: the time-saving tips and professional shortcuts that will allow you to work faster, smarter, and more creatively with Photoshop CS2.

Rating: 5 out of 5 stars - This is the bible...
This really is the top pick for a book on Photoshop CS2. Keep in mind though that it is much more of a manual than a tutorial. It is probably a bit of a steep learning curve for an absolute beginner. It has far more depth than almost any other book on the subject. It also lives up to its title "Real World" in that the authors give very useful pragmatic advice as to what is actually useful and how best to apply the tools to situations you are likely to encounter. It IS NOT a step-by-step tutorial. If I had to have only one book on Photoshop it would be this one. If you are truely starting from scratch I'd recommend that you supplement this book with a few online tutorials just to get you up and playing with the software a little before diving into the details.
